The Smiling Peanut (Jimmy Carter Commemoration)
The Smiling Peanut, also known as the Jimmy Carter Peanut, is a unique tourist attraction located at 120 Buena Vista Road in Plains, Georgia, United States. Standing at thirteen feet tall, this iconic peanut sculpture was originally created by members of the Indiana Democratic Party for a political rally in Evansville before finding its home in Plains. The peanut now sits in front of a convenience store near the Jimmy Carter National Historical Park Visitor Center, just a short distance from Plains High School. It was once housed at the railroad depot, which served as the headquarters for Jimmy Carter's presidential campaign.

Midway Museum
The Midway Museum, located at 491 North Coastal Highway in Midway, Georgia, is a historical institution and tourist attraction with a vast collection of 18th- and 19th-century heirloom furnishings, paintings, documents, and artifacts. Situated just four miles from I-95, south of Savannah, the museum offers guided tours lasting 45 minutes, Tuesday through Saturday from 10 am to 4 pm. Only up to 10 visitors are allowed at a time, with admission prices set at $10 for adults, $8 for seniors/military, and $5 for children. The museum is part of the Midway Historic District, which also includes the 1792 Midway Church and cemetery. Visitors praise the museum for its knowledgeable staff, captivating stories, and well-preserved exhibits, making it a must-visit for history enthusiasts. The Midway Museum operates as a non-profit organization and relies on donations and memberships for support. Visitors can also follow the museum's Facebook page for updates on special events.
